Alis Al Islam Passes Bowling Action Test and Prepares for Return to BPL
Mystery spinner Aliss Al Islam, known for his economical bowling and early breakthroughs, has successfully passed the bowling action test after facing issues in the ongoing Bangladesh Premier League (BPL). The spinner, who had been under scrutiny for his action, underwent the test on Saturday at the Home of Cricket, Mirpur, and received a positive result, clearing him to continue playing in the tournament.
Alis faced difficulties with his bowling action during the January 19th match between Barishal and Chattogram. The umpires deemed his action to be suspect, and the Chattogram Kings, despite not officially making a statement, were aware of the issue. National team selector Hannan Sarkar had also raised concerns about the legality of his bowling action before the match. The head of the BPL Technical Committee, Rokibul Hasan, later confirmed the news.
This isn't the first time Alis' action has come under scrutiny. During the 2019 BPL, in his debut match for Dhaka Dynamites, his bowling action was questioned, leading him to face another test.
After passing the test, Alis is now eligible to continue playing in the ongoing BPL season. He has been in impressive form, taking 12 wickets in 8 matches so far. Alis is now ready to make his return to Chattogram Kings’ playing XI as they look to continue their campaign in the tournament.
